Simplify compliance and management of multiple backups with centralized cloud solutions
AWS Backup could benefit from including more services. Currently, it only includes around ten services, while AWS offers over three hundred plus services. Also, it would be helpful if AWS Backup could integrate logs more thoroughly. This would allow not only new users but also experienced users to more easily check logs directly from AWS Backup.

Cons

"For additional functionalities, it should be more intelligent, like more AI-capabilities."
"There are multiple enhancements needed in terms of compatibility with all database services, as AWS Backup is currently limited to specific ones."
"It could be less expensive."
"One of the limitations of AWS Backup is that it only does file-based copying."
"There could be a centralized dashboard with a reporting feature notifying us of daily backup status."
"One improvement I would like to see in AWS Backup is the implementation of incremental backups."
"The AWS Backup backend reporting is a major area that needs improvement. We would be very excited if we can see some reporting, such as trends. We do understand that there are reports available for S3 Bucket, in which the AWS backend stores the data. However, if we can receive holistic reporting, then it would be very helpful for us."
"It requires a lot of time to connect the snapshot, identify the files, and restore a single file manually."
"The licensing could be improved, particularly by providing a 'pay-as-you-go' option through Azure, AWS, or GCP portal itself."

Pricing and Cost Advice

"The product is inexpensive."
"Price-wise, I rate the solution a six out of ten. One only has to pay for the storage cost of AWS solutions, which is the standard cost provided by AWS."
"AWS Backup is a very cheap solution."
"We don't use a lot of space, only approximately 900 GB, so the price is reasonable. For standing, it's okay. We normally do a payment to SSML, and they are the ones who pay over there. It is around $100 monthly."
"AWS is more expensive than some competitors like Azure."
"AWS Backup is free of cost, but we need to pay for the backup storage being used."
"The clients pay for the whole AWS bundle. It is an affordable solution."
"It's a myth that Cloud is cheap. Cloud is cheap initially, but the cost over time can be equal to your own infrastructure if you consume a lot."
